César Pinares (full name César Ignacio Pinares Tamayo) is a Chilean soccer player.
César Miguel Rebosio Compans is a Peruvian retired footballer who played as a defender. Rebosio played for five different teams in his country, and also had abroad stints with Greece's PAOK F.C. and Real Zaragoza and UD Almería in Spain.
César Baldaccini, known as César (1921-1998) was a French sculptor and experimental artist.
César Millán Favela is one of the most famous dog trainers in the world. (Though he prefers to say he "trains humans and rehabilitates dogs".)
César-Auguste-Jean-Guillaume-Hubert Franck (December 10, 1822 – November 8, 1890), a composer, organist and music teacher of Belgian origin, was one of the great figures in classical music in France (and the world) in the second half of the 19th century.
César Antonovich Cui (Russian: Цезарь Антонович Кюи, Cezar' Antonovič Kjui) (January 6, 1835 (Old Style)-March 13, 1918) was a Russian of French and Lithuanian descent. His profession was as an army officer and a teacher of fortifications; his avocational life has particular significance in the history of music, in that he was a composer and music critic; in this sideline he is known as a member of The Five, the group of Russian composers under the leadership of Mily Balakirev dedicated to the production of a specifically Russian brand of music.
César Manrique (April 24, 1919 in Arrecife - September 25, 1992 in Fundación, part of Teguise) was an artist and an architect.
César Rincón is a Spanish bullfighter.
